#583f2e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#583f2e is composed of 34.5% red, 24.7% green and 18%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 28.4% magenta, 47.7% yellow and 65.5% black. It has a hue angle of 24.3 degrees, a saturation of 31.3% and a lightness of 26.3%. #583f2e color hex could be obtained by blending #b07e5c with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#663333.

● #583f2e color description : Very dark desaturated orange.
#583f2e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#583f2e has RGB values of R:88, G:63, B:46 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.28, Y:0.48, K:0.65. Its decimal value is 5783342.

Shades and Tints of #583f2e
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0b0806 is the darkest color, while #fefdfd is the lightest one.

Tones of #583f2e
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#434343 is the less saturated color, while #813705 is the most saturated one.
